Let’s break it down. Thirty-six states in the U.S. do ask for some kind of ID when you show up to vote. But out of those 36, only 24 are big on the whole “show us your photo ID” thing; the other 12 are fine with any ID as long as it’s something. But of the states Harris won, 12 of them, including heavy-hitters like California, Oregon, and New York, don’t ask for ID at all. Just stroll in, say you’re here to vote, and that’s pretty much that.
Five of the other states Harris won—Colorado, Washington, Delaware, Connecticut, and Virginia—technically ask for ID, but they’re not super picky about it being a photo ID. And in places like Colorado and Washington, where most of the voting happens by mail, the ID laws are just for in-person voters, so it doesn’t come up much anyway.
VISIT OUR YOUTUBE CHANNELNow, in states like Delaware, Connecticut, and Virginia, if you show up without an ID, no big deal. You can sign an affidavit swearing that you’re really you, and off you go to cast your regular ballot. It’s sort of like promising you’ll totally bring your ID next time (wink wink).
Then we have New Hampshire, where Harris also won. They let you vote without an ID, too — but they’re a bit more suspicious. You’ve got to sign a “challenged voter affidavit” (fancy words for “Are you sure you’re not lying?”) before they hand over a ballot. After the election, they’ll even send you a letter that you have to sign and return. If you don’t, guess what? Voter fraud investigation time! Seems New Hampshire isn’t here to play.
Rhode Island is the only state Harris won that doesn’t mess around with the no-ID crowd. If you don’t have an ID there, you’re looking at a provisional ballot only. Then they’ll compare your signature to one they have on file. So, don’t get fancy with the handwriting.
On the flip side, a few states Harris lost, like Nevada and Pennsylvania, also don’t require an ID. But it’s worth noting Nevada voters recently passed Question 7, which will make photo IDs a must in future elections. Pennsylvania also tried to get on the strict ID bandwagon back in 2012, but the state’s supreme court struck it down.
